diff --git a/source/dub/compilers/dmd.d b/source/dub/compilers/dmd.d index ed35530..aeafb46 100644 --- a/source/dub/compilers/dmd.d +++ b/source/dub/compilers/dmd.d @@ -115,7 +115,7 @@ auto tpath = Path(settings.targetPath) ~ getTargetFileName(settings, platform); version(Windows){ string[] libs = settings.dflags.dup.filter!(l => l.endsWith(".lib"))().array() ~ settings.sourceFiles; - string arg = format("%s,%s,,%s", objects.join("+"), tpath.toNativeString(), libs.join("+")); + string arg = format("%s,%s,,%s/co/noi", objects.join("+"), tpath.toNativeString(), libs.join("+")); logDebug("link.exe %s", arg); auto res = spawnProcess(["link.exe", arg]).wait(); } else {